## Support

The Monthwise module manages automatic table partitioning by calendar month for the Ledgerholt warehouse. Before approving changes, please verify that the partition-boundary tests in `tests/partitions/` pass, and confirm that retention jobs are not scheduled against partitions still receiving writes. Edge cases around month rollover at midnight UTC are documented in `docs/rollover.md`. Questions about intended behavior, or suspected regressions in partition pruning, should be sent to the maintainers at the address below.

alerts address for yajof-kahog: eliax@qirvanlabs.corp

## Step 4: Regenerate the static-analysis baseline

After upgrading Fernspect to the 3.x scanner, the old baseline file is no longer compatible and must be regenerated. Do this from a clean checkout so pre-existing suppressions are re-evaluated rather than carried forward blindly. Review every finding that the new engine refuses to baseline—those are usually real. Commit the regenerated file in its own change so the diff is auditable. The regeneration step reads its settings from the values below.

service settings:
[casax]
port = 6379
team = rusir
host = casax.zemvarhq.corp
region = outer-4
access_code = ac_9808ce
timeout_ms = 1500

14:22 — The Quietbell alert deduplicator resumed normal operation after rollback. Earlier, a fingerprinting change caused distinct alerts from separate clusters to collapse into one notification, masking a disk-pressure page for eleven minutes. On-call engineer Marisol rolled back to the prior release and confirmed alert counts matched the raw stream. Future maintainers: fingerprint changes require the shadow-compare job before deploy. The rollback corresponds to the build token below.

build token for kagaf-hahof: htk14_9d3d4d26d7d8de